Promise based additional methods on the deepstream js client (polyfilled)
npm install extended-ds-clientPromise based deepstream client. It's basically the deepstream.io-client-js with basic calls promisified, plus some extra methods. All methods are added as polyfills.
```
npm i -S extended-ds-client
Creating a client through this package will give you additional methods on the client object, leaving everything from the default client untouched (getRecord, getList etc).

Alias: record.getExistingRecordP
Additional method that does a .has-check before .getRecord to get a record handler without implicit record creation (Compare with snapshot that also fails if the record does not exist, but returns the actual record instead of a record handler). It rejects the promise if the record does not exist.
`js`
client.record.p.getExistingRecord(name)
.then(dsRecord => ...)
.catch(error => ...);

Alias: record.updateExistingRecordP
Update a record, choosing from one of multiple update modes:
* shallow: Default mode. Overwrite each property at the base level.overwrite
* : Replace the whole record.deep
* : Deep merge of the updates into record (using lodash.merge).deepConcat
* : Deep merge, but concatenate arrays with only simple values.deepConcatAll
* : Merge like deepConcat, but concatenate ALL arrays.deepIgnore
* : Deep merge, but leave unchanged if some value in updates is '%IGNORE%'.deepConcatIgnore
* : Merge like deepConcat, but skip values like deepIgnore.removeKeys
* : With updates as an array, remove corresponding keys in record.
Two additional array arguments, lockedKeys and protectedKeys, makes it possible to lock or protect given keys, regardless of update mode. Locked keys won't be altered and protected ones won't be removed.

Alias: record.getDatasetRecordP
In case you often end up with the structure of having a list of some type of records as the "parent" of those records. For example a list of all bookings at bookings and the bookings at bookings/room-19, bookings/room-27 etc.
On resolve you get back both the deepstream list handle and record handle.
The options described in getClient above will influence how this function operates.
`js`
client.record.p.getDatasetRecord('bookings', 'room-27').then(([dsList, dsRecord]) => {
const booking = dsRecord.get();
console.log(dsList.getEntries());
console.log(booking.time, '-', booking.customer);
});
